Be aware of your opponent’s strengths and weaknesses

When playing against an opponent, it is important to be aware of their strengths and weaknesses. If you know what shots they are good at, you can plan your game around avoiding these shots. If you know which shots they are weakest at, you can take advantage of this by hitting these shots often. By knowing your opponent’s strengths and weaknesses, you can become a better player and have a better chance of winning the match.

Take care of your tennis racket so it will last longer

  • Clean the racket after every use with a damp cloth
  • Store the racket in a dry place when not in use
  • Apply tennis racket protection to the frame and strings of the racket before storing
  • Do not leave the racket in direct sunlight
  • Do not store the racket in a humid place
